What is Ice Plus on an LG Refrigerator?

The Ice Plus function is a specialized feature found in many LG refrigerator models that optimizes ice production. This feature is particularly useful during occasions when you need a larger quantity of ice, such as parties, gatherings, or even during the hot summer months when demand for cold beverages rises.

When activated, Ice Plus temporarily boosts the refrigerator’s cooling system, allowing the ice maker to produce more ice in a shorter amount of time. This is achieved by lowering the temperature of the freezer compartment, which accelerates the freezing process.

How Long Should You Use Ice Plus?

While the Ice Plus feature can be incredibly useful, it’s important to know when to turn it off. Continuous use of the feature can lead to excessive ice accumulation, which could eventually damage the machine or impede its functionality.

Recommendations for Duration

While there’s no strict time limit for using Ice Plus, consider the following guidelines:

  • For small gatherings: Activate Ice Plus about two hours before your event.
  • For larger parties: You may want to turn on Ice Plus four hours ahead of time to ensure ample ice supply.

After your event, it is advisable to turn off the Ice Plus feature. Doing so will allow your refrigerator to return to its normal energy-efficient cooling mode.

Potential Drawbacks of Ice Plus

Despite its many benefits, some users have reported a few concerns associated with the Ice Plus feature. Understanding these drawbacks can help you make informed decisions about when and how to use it.

1. Noisy Operation

As the Ice Plus feature engages, you may notice your refrigerator running more loudly than usual. This is due to the compressor working harder to lower the temperature. While this noise is typically not harmful, it can be bothersome in quiet environments.

2. Increased Power Consumption

While Ice Plus can be energy efficient in certain contexts, it does require more power during operation. If you are particularly conscious about your electricity bills or living in an area with high energy costs, it’s wise to use Ice Plus sparingly.

2. Temperature Settings

If your refrigerator or freezer is not set to the appropriate temperature, it can impact ice production as well. The recommended settings are typically around 0°F (-18°C) for the freezer and between 32°F to 40°F (0°C to 4°C) for the refrigerator.

What is the Ice Plus feature on my LG refrigerator?

The Ice Plus feature is a specialized function designed to increase the production of ice in your LG refrigerator. By activating this feature, the appliance will work to create ice more quickly, making it ideal for times when you expect a higher demand for ice, such as during parties or gatherings.

This function typically operates by lowering the temperature in the freezer compartment for a specific period, allowing the ice maker to produce ice at a faster rate. Once the desired amount of ice is made or the set time has elapsed, the refrigerator automatically returns to its normal operating temperature to maintain energy efficiency.

How long does the Ice Plus feature run?

The Ice Plus function typically runs for a set duration, which can vary by model but usually lasts around 24 hours. This period allows your refrigerator to maximize ice production significantly. However, it will auto-disable after the specified length of time unless you choose to turn it off manually before that.

Monitoring your ice levels during this time can help you assess whether you need to keep the feature activated longer or if you can return the refrigerator to its standard ice production settings.

Can I use Ice Plus if my ice maker is turned off?

You generally cannot use the Ice Plus feature if your ice maker is turned off. The Ice Plus function works in conjunction with the ice maker to enhance its output, so if the ice maker is disabled, there will be no ice production to accelerate.

If you need extra ice, be sure to turn on the ice maker first. Once it is activated, you can then proceed to turn on the Ice Plus feature to boost ice production as needed.
